Michele Yvette Bryant{{cite web|url=http://www.discogs.com/artist/Yvette+Michele?anv=Yvette+Michelle |title=Discogs.com |publisher=Discogs.com |access-date=2011-03-11}} (born December 17, 1968{{cite web|url=https://cocatalog.loc.gov/cgi-bin/Pwebrecon.cgi?Search_Arg=Bryant%2C+Michele+Y.%2C+1968-&Search_Code=NALL&PID=uHREPl21A96ZYotNicju6HRXmYih&SEQ=20240818162622&CNT=25&HIST=1 |title=United States Copyright Office|publisher=United States Copyright Office |access-date=2024-08-18}}), known professionally as Yvette Michele, is an American R&B singer.

Career

Michele released her debut album, My Dream, on August 26, 1997 on the RCA record label. From 1996-1998 she released three Top 20 singles on the US Billboard Hot Dance Music/Maxi-Singles Sales chart, "Everyday & Everynight" (#3),[http://www.billboard.com/bbcom/esearch/chart_display.jsp?cfi=360&cfgn=Singles&cfn=Hot+Dance+Music%2FMaxi-Singles+Sales&ci=3023383&cdi=7059699&cid=05%2F18%2F1996]{{dead link|date=July 2024|bot=medic}}{{cbignore|bot=medic}} "I'm Not Feeling You" (#5) [http://www.billboard.com/bbcom/esearch/chart_display.jsp?cfi=360&cfgn=Singles&cfn=Hot+Dance+Music%2FMaxi-Singles+Sales&ci=3025883&cdi=7150649&cid=02%2F22%2F1997]{{dead link|date=July 2024|bot=medic}}{{cbignore|bot=medic}} and "DJ Keep Playin' (Get Your Music On)" (#19).[http://www.billboard.com/bbcom/esearch/chart_display.jsp?cfi=360&cfgn=Singles&cfn=Hot+Dance+Music%2FMaxi-Singles+Sales&ci=3028450&cdi=7241518&cid=10%2F25%2F1997]{{dead link|date=July 2024|bot=medic}}{{cbignore|bot=medic}}

On March 5, 1997 "I'm Not Feeling You" was awarded the Billboard 'Greatest Gainer Sales' award for the biggest sales gain of the week.{{cite book|url=https://books.google.com/books?id=aA4EAAAAMBAJ&q=Yvette+Michele&pg=PA117 |title=Billboard - Google Books |date=1997-03-15 |access-date=2011-03-11}}

Also, she participated in the song "Far From Yours" of the rapper O.C.
